Since 1996, McLusky has carved out a distinct niche in the music scene, blending sharp humor with a fiercely raw sound that resonates deeply with fans. Originating from Cardiff, United Kingdom, the band has built a loyal following over the years, thanks to their relentless touring and commitment to delivering high-octane performances. The Chapel, located at 777 Valencia St in the heart of San Francisco, offers an intimate and inviting atmosphere that is perfect for a band like McLusky. With a capacity that allows for close interaction, the venue creates an engaging environment where every note resonates.
